Orca Auto 1300
The Orca Auto 1300 is an automatic submersible bilge pump for use in marine vessels. Output
capacity depends on installation and operating conditions.

Orca Auto 1300 is designed for installation in recreational marine vessels only and operated on 12V
d.c. (BE1482) or 24 V d.c. (BE1484) electrical supply only. If it is intended for use for any other
purpose or with any other liquid, it is the user's responsibility to ensure that the pump is suitable for
the intended use and, in particular, that the materials are fully compatible with the liquids to be used.
The Orca Auto 1300 is not recommended for domestic applications.
The Orca Auto is recommended to have a Duty Cycle of 60%

Preparation - Always disconnect power sources before installation.
9.i Location
• Choose a position to mount the pump that is dry and away from standing water and is free
from obstacles.
•Mount in a position with the shortest possible pipe run lengths.
9.ii ounting Instructions
• To remove pump body, place hand over body, depress
locking tabs (eyes) and lift body from strainer base ( igure
1). NOTE: Motor will be removed with body
•Use base as template to mark 3 mounting holes in
mounting pad.
•Drill 1/8" (3mm) pilot holes. NOTE: do not drill through hull;
ensure that the Orca is mounted securely to additional
board or bulkhead.
• Use 25mm (1”) or 28mm (1 1/8”) smooth bore reinforced
hose to connect to the strainer with hose clips.
•Replace base. Attach with #8 stainless steel fasteners (supplied).
•Re-attach pump body to base. Insert body into strainer base, until base tabs snap into holes.
9.iii Plumbing
For optimal performance: The hose must rise continually upward to the thru-hull connector with no
dips or sharp bends. Hose support clips should be used at regular intervals where necessary.
•Orientate the pump outlet for a direct path
to the hull connector ensuring an
unobstructed hose path.
•Secure all connections with hose clamps.
•If no thru-hull connector exists, install at
12" (25mm) minimum height above
water line. Apply marine sealant around
thru-hull flanges on interior and exterior
of hull.

9.iv Electrical Wiring
Ensure all wire connections are at the highest level above water. Use marine grade
wire connectors only and 16 AWG tinned copper wire. Waterproof all connections
with suitable materials (see figure 3).
• Connect positive (+) brown
and white stripe wire to the
automatic side of the switch.
• Connect negative (-) black
wire to ground.
• Connect yellow crimp to
manual side of switch. DO
NOT disconnect the brown
and white solid wires from the
yellow crimp.
•Install a fuse holder within 72"
(183cm) of the positive (+)
battery terminal.
•To test system, feed water into
the pump. If flow rate appears
low, ensure wires are connected properly:
Brown and white stripe to positive Black to negative (battery)
NOTE - Reversed wiring reduces performance and can cause pump failure.
• If you are not familiar with applicable electrical standards, ensure that the unit is installed by
a qualified electrician/ technician.
WARNING: ire hazard. Wiring must comply with applicable electrical standards and include a
properly rated fuse or circuit breaker. Improper wiring can cause a fire resulting in injury or death.
NOTE Switch off the power prior to making connections. Suggested wiring information is given as a
guide only. or full information, refer to the USCG, ABYC and ISO regulations for marine
applications and wiring gauges, connectors and fuse protection.
9.v FITTING THE FUSE
use rating for BE1482 (12V d.c.) pumps - 7.5 Amp automotive.
use rating for BE1484 (24V d.c.) pumps - 5 Amp automotive
An in-line fuse assembly must be fitted to the positive side of the pump.
PURPOSE OF FUSE: The purpose of this fuse is to protect the pump from serious damage in the
event of system blockages, therefore please ensure all valves are fully open before operating the
pump.

11. TROUBLESHOOTING
PROBLEM POSSIBLE CAUSES POTENTIAL SOLUTION
Pump runs but
does not pump
water / pulses
Hose may have
blockage or airlock
Clear the hose of any blockages and ensure that outlet
hose runs upward to the thru-hull connector, with no
dips
Impeller may be
restricted
Remove pump housing from base. Remove debris from
chamber and impeller. Ensure that the impeller is firmly
attached to shaft and is not cracked or broken
Pump does not run Blown fuse Ensure electrical connections and fuse are waterproof
and have not loosened
Motor speed variation
when running dry
Some variation is normal but ensure that the yellow crimp has not been
removed or that the brown and white wires have been shortened
(normally 1m long)
The fuse blows
a) Check that all system valves/stop cocks are open
b) Check that the inlet and outlet ports are not blocked
c) Check that the rest of the system is not blocked
d) Check for reverse polarity connection
